What Does A Cv Joint Cost. The price to replace a cv joint, or joints, will depend on the age, make, and model of your vehicle. If you own a mainstream affordable vehicle, the price to replace a cv joint is likely to run in the range of $900 to $1200. The national average cost of cv joint replacement ranges from $200 to $500, with labor expenses being a significant portion of the overall cost. The average cost for replacing a cv axle is $809 to $1,074 depending if you go to the mechanic or diy. This price is based on national averages.
